Citizenship Application
Type: Online
Location: Brampton
Physical Presence Days: 1105
Application: single
Application sent: JAN 01
Delivered : 1st Jan
AOR : 15th Jan
Background Complete : 9th March
----------------
Updates :
Test Invite : 29th March (Guys invitation mail comes after 2-3 of update on website)
Test Interview date : 31st March to 20th April (IRCC gives a window of 20 days. You can appear on any given day or time)
Test given and passed : 2nd April

Total time spent for preparation : 5 hours. Read PDF print 3 times. Test is very easy. Need not remember any dates. Just remember key stuff. No sports or freedom fighter names to be remembered. I scored 17 out of 20
